Roman Military Roof Tile 14th Legion ( Gemina) 1st Century AD Roman Military Roof Tile 14th Legion ( Gemina) 1st Century AD Ref: 1-SN3899
A very rare -large section of Roman Military Roof Tile .This item shows the Military stamp of the 14th Legion ( Gemina )This item which dates from the 1 st Century AD,still has much white wash on its surface.The 14th Legion were the Roman troops which defeated the Warriors of the British Iron Age Queen Boudicca.The tile stamp shows X1111G The G STANDING FOR GEMINA -that is because the 14th Legion was comprised of two Legions which were amalgamated to form one.This is in fact where the star sign GEMINI comes from , which are- as we know TWINS. - Size 21.0 x 15.5 CM

A large Rare Roman Brick -Made By The 1st LEGION -( ITALICA )A large Rare Roman Brick -Made By The 1st LEGION -( ITALICA ) Ref: 1-SN4491
Ancient Roman Antiquities & Artifacts- Roman Pottery

A large rare Roman brick -made by the 1st LEGION -( ITALICA ) ,at Olpia Oescus on the Lower Danube .This was one of the Emporer Trajans strategic bases, prior to the second invasion Of Dacia in 106 AD - LEG1 ITAL.Rare and seldom seen .A real collectors item..Complete with wooden base.Size 21 x 20 x 7 CM-An interesting point to this piece, is that the Legionary soldier who made this item left his finger prints on the outside- which are still visable.today..

SOLD-A Very Rare Roman Military Large Tile Fragment.. SOLD-A Very Rare Roman Military Large Tile Fragment.. Ref: 1-SN3892.
Ancient Roman Antiquities & Artifacts- Roman Pottery

The Tile has the 15th Legion cypher mark impressed into the surface.The I 5th Legion named the Apollininaris -were named after the God Apollo, they fought in the Jewish Wars of 66-70 AD .A detachment also took part in the Dacian Wars of the Emperor Trajan in 101-102 AD and 105-106 AD.
